談談虛擬語氣
如果你看到下列的句子,,你會認為它們是正確的還是錯的呢,? 1.I wish I were a bird. 2.We request that you be here tomorrow. 也許你會說:"哈哈,第一句的 I were 錯了,,應該是 I was,;而第二句中的 you be是什么東東呀?不是 you are, 也不是 you will be, 什么 you be?!"其實上面的句子都是一種稱為 Subjunctive 類型的句子,。Subjunctive Mood 有的書譯為"假設語氣",,雖不很貼切;但在相當大的程度上,,告訴我們這種句子的特點,。Subjunctive Mood中文譯作"虛擬語氣",似乎不及"假設語氣"那么容易明白,。它是一種動詞形式,,表示說話人的某種假設、愿望,、懷疑,、猜測、建議等含義,?;旧希摂M語氣可分為虛擬現(xiàn)在(Subjunctive Present)和虛擬過去(Subjunctive Past)兩種,;但它們和時態(tài)(Tenses)上所指的現(xiàn)在時態(tài)(Present Tense)和過去時態(tài)(Past Tense)是有所不同的,。 一、虛擬現(xiàn)在(Subjunctive Present): 虛擬現(xiàn)在的句子,,在任何時候都要用動詞的原形(root form),,就算是第三人稱(he,she, it)也是如此。如: 1.1 現(xiàn)在時態(tài)(Simple Present): (右邊為虛擬語氣) I work ---- I work you work ---- you work he works ---- he work (注意到了嗎,是 work,,不是 works) she works ---- she work (不是 she works 喔) it works ---- it work (同樣不是 it works 喔) we work ---- we work they work ---- they work 1.2 現(xiàn)在進行時態(tài)(Present Continuous):(右邊為虛擬語氣) I am working ---- I be working (注意用的是 be,,怪怪的!) you are working ---- you be working he is working ---- he be working she is working ---- she be working it is working ---- it be working we are working ---- we be working they are woring ---- they be working 1.3 現(xiàn)在完成時態(tài)(Present Perfect):(右邊為虛擬語氣) I have worked ---- I have worked you have worked ---- you have worked he has worked ----- he have worked (用的還是have喔) she has worked ---- she have worked it has worked ---- it have worked we have worked ---- we have worked they have worked ---- they have worked 1.4 現(xiàn)在完成進行時態(tài)(Present Perfect Continuous):(右邊為虛擬語氣) I have been working ---- I have been working you have been working ---- you have been working he has been working ---- he have been working (是 he have, 不是 he has ) she has been working ---- she have been working it has been working --- it have been working we have been working ---- we have been working they have been working ---- they have been working 談談虛擬語氣(Subjunctive Mood)(二) 二、虛擬過去(Subjunctive Past) 虛擬過去的動詞無論在什么情況之下都要用過去復數(shù)形式,。如:動詞 be,,在虛擬過去中要用 were。 2.1 過去時態(tài)(Simple Past):(右邊為虛擬語氣) I worked ---- I worked you worked ---- you worked he worked ---- he worked she worked ---- she worked it worked ---- it worked we worked ---- we worked they worked ---- they worked 2.2 過去進行時態(tài)(Past Continuous):(右邊為虛擬語氣) I was working ---- I were working (注意是 I were) you were working ---- you were working he was working ---- he were working (是 he were 喔) she was working ---- she were working it was working ---- it were working we were working ---- we were working they were working ---- they were working 2.3 過去完成時態(tài)(Past Perfect):(右邊為虛擬語氣) I had worked ---- I had worked you had worked ---- you had worked he had worked ---- he had worked she had worked ---- she had worked it had worked ---- it had worked we had worked ---- we had worked they had worked ---- they had worked (耶,,全部都用 had ! ) 2.4 過去完成進行時態(tài)(Past Perfect Continuous):(右邊為虛擬語氣) I had been working ---- I had been working you had been working ---- you had been working he had been working ---- he had been working she had been working ---- she had been working it had been working ---- it had been working we had been working ---- we had been working they had been working ---- they had been working 談談虛擬語氣(Subjunctive Mood)(三) 三,、簡單的祝愿和命令: 3.1 祝愿 1.May you be happy. (注意那個be)祝你幸福。 2.May you have a good time. 3.May the friendship between us last long, 4.Have a good journey! 祝你旅途愉快,! 3.2 命令 注意: 1.命令虛擬語氣只能用在第二人稱(you),,而且通常省略主語(也就是you)。 2.句子尾通常加上感嘆號:,! 3.虛擬語氣動詞用一般現(xiàn)在時態(tài)(Simple Present),,如:work, be , go 4.否定形式的命令語氣,可用助動詞 do,,加上 not,。 1.Work ! 2.Work harder ! 3.Be more alert ! (虛擬語氣動詞 Be) 4.You go out ! 5.Do not work so hard. (do not 表示否定的虛擬語氣) 6.Don't be afraid. (口語中常用don't 代替 do not) 談談虛擬語氣(Subjunctive Mood)(四) 四、在現(xiàn)在時態(tài)句里,,用情態(tài)動詞(Modal Verb)的過去時態(tài)(could,might,should,would)表示說話人的謙虛,、客氣、有禮,、委婉等: 1. Would you be kind enough to show me the way to the post office.(情態(tài)動詞 would,表示客氣有禮) 2. It would be better for you not to stay up too late.(表示委婉) 五,、虛擬語氣在賓語從句(Subordinate Clasue)中的用法: 5.1 在wish后的虛擬語氣賓語從句(可省略它的that): 表示: a.和現(xiàn)在的事實相反; b.和過去的事實相反,; c.對將來的主觀愿望,。 5.1.1 現(xiàn)在情況的虛擬,從句用過去式或過去進行式(時間上是同時的): 1. I wish (that可省略,下同)I knew the answer to the question.(wish, 動詞過去式 knew) 我希望知道這個答案,。(事實上是不知道) 2. I wish it were spring in my hometown all the year around.(wish, were) 但愿我的家鄉(xiāng)四季如春,。(事實上不可能) 3. I wish I were a bird.(wish, were) 但愿我是只小鳥。(事實上不可能,難道是鳥人,?呵呵) 4. When she was at the party,she wished she were at home. (wished,過去虛擬動詞were)(事實上并不在家) 5. Now that he is in China, he wishes he understood Chinese.(wishes,過去虛擬動詞understood) 現(xiàn)在他在中國,,他希望能懂得中文。(事實上并不懂) 6. When we begin the trip, they will wish they were with us. (will wish,過去虛擬動詞were)(事實上并不和我們在一起) 5.1.2 過去情況的虛擬,,從句動詞用"had + 過去分詞"(時間上較前): 1. I wish (that可省略,,下同)I hadn't wasted so much time. 我后悔不該浪費這么多時間。(事實上已浪費了) 2. He wishes he hadn't lost the chance. 他真希望沒有失去機會,。(其實已失去) 3. We wished he had spoken to us. (wished,,had + spoken)(事實上他并沒同我們講) 4. I wish you had called earlier. (wish, had + called)(事實上已遲了) 5. They will wish they had listened to us sooner. (will wish,had + listened)(事實上并不如此) 5.1.3 將來情況的虛擬(表示將來的主觀愿望),,從句動詞用"would/should/could/might + 動詞原形"(時間上較后): 1. I wish it would stop raining.(虛擬動詞would+動詞原形stop) 我希望雨能停止。(事實上雨還在下著呢) 2. I wish you would be quiet.(would + be) 我希望你安靜一些,。(事實上那家伙還在吵著呢) 3. You wished she would arrive the next day.(would + arrive) 你希望她第二天會到,。(事實上她還沒到) 4. I wish she would change her mind.(would + change) 我希望她會改變主意。(呵呵,,女孩子可沒那么容易就改變主意喔) 5. He will wish we would join him the following week.(would + join) (只是希望我們和他在一起,,實際上還沒在一起) 談談虛擬語氣(Subjunctive Mood)(五) 5.2 除了wish之外,下列各動詞(如 suggest)的后面的虛擬語氣賓語從句,,其謂語用:"should + 動詞原形"表示建議(suggest),、堅持(insist)等虛擬語氣: * suggest (建議), recommend (推薦), advise (勸告), propose (建議) * insist (堅持), consent (允諾) * decide (決定), order (命令) * request (要求), demand (要求), desire (期望), ask (要求) * maintain (主張), urge (催促) 1.I suggest that we (should 可省略,下同) start the meeting at once. (suggest, should + start) (表示建議立即開會) 2.The doctor suggested that he (should ) try to lose his weight. (suggested, should + try) (表示建議你應該減肥喔) 3. He insisted that all of us (should) be there on time by any mains. (insisted, should + be) (表示堅持,無論如何都要準時到那兒,。你再講也沒用哩,!) 4. He insisted that we (should) tell him the news. (insisted, should + tell) (表示非要你告訴他不可) 5. He ordered that the students (should) wash the clothes every week by themselves. (ordered, should + wash) (表示命令學生們每周自己洗衣服) 六、虛擬語氣在表語從句,、同位語從句中的用法: 下列名詞后的表語從句或同位語從句,,也用"should + 動詞原形" 表示虛擬語氣: * demand (要求), desire (請求),requirment (要求) * advice (勸告), recommendation (建議),suggestion (建議) * order (命令) * necessity (必要地), preference (優(yōu)先) * proposal (計劃), plan (計劃), idea (辦法) 1.The advice is that we (should 可省略,下同) leave at once. (名詞advice,,should + leave) (表示加以勸告) 2. My idea is that we (should) get more people to attend the conference. (idea, should + get) (表示做出主意) 3. I make a proposal that we (should) hold a meeting next week. (proposal, should + hold) (表示做出計劃) 談談虛擬語氣(Subjunctive Mood)(六) 七,、虛擬語氣在主語從句中的用法 句型:It is (或was) + 形容詞(或過去分詞) + that …… +should + 動詞原形…… 句子:It is natural that she should do so. (形容詞natural, should+動詞原形do) 常用的形容詞: * natural (自然的), appropriate (適當?shù)?,advisable (合適的), preferable (更可取的), better (更好的) * necessary (必須的), important (重要的), imperative (急需的), urgent (急迫的), essential (本質的), vital (必不可少的) * probable (很可能的), possible (可能的) * desirable (極好的) 常用的過去分詞(Past Participle): * required (需要的), demanded (要求), requested (被請求的), desired (要求) * suggested (建議), recommended (推薦) * orderd (命令) 1. It is necessary that we (should 可省略,下同)have a walk now. (necessary, should + have) (表示有需要去散步) 2.It was necessary that we (should) make everything ready ahead of time. (necessary, should + make) (表示有必要事先做好準備) 3. It is required that nobody (should) smoke here. (required, should + smoke) (表示要求不要在此抽煙) 4. It is important that every pupil (should) be able to understand the rule of school. (important, should + be) (表示重要的是學生都能了解校規(guī)) 5. It's important that we (should) take good care of the patient. (important, should + take) (表示重要的是照顧好病人) 談談虛擬語氣(Subjunctive Mood)(七) 八、虛擬語氣在條件從句(Protasis)中的用法: 條件從句有兩類:(1)真實條件句,;(2)虛擬條件句,。如果假設情況有可能發(fā)生的,就是"真實條件句",。如: 1. If time permits, we'll go fishing together. (如果有時間的話,,我們就一起去釣魚。) 如果假設的情況與事實相反,,則為"虛擬條件句",。如: 1. If it had rained yesterday, we would have stayed at home. (如果昨天下雨的話,,我們就會留在家里,。) 這回我們要談的就是關于"虛擬條件句"的一些句型。 * 這種句子一般由"從句"(Subordinate Clause)和"主句"(Main Clause)組成,。如上 例: If it had rained yesterday, we would have stayed at home. "If it had rained yesterday" 就是"從句",;"we would have stayed at home" 則為"主句。 * 無論"從句"或"主句"的謂語都要用虛擬語氣,。它們所用的動詞有三種時態(tài)(Tenses),,就是:現(xiàn)在時態(tài)、過去時態(tài),、將來時態(tài),。 * 句型: 8.1 與現(xiàn)在事實相反的假設(事情的發(fā)生都在同一時間內(nèi)): 從句:if + 主語 + 動詞的過去式(be 用 were) + …… 主句:主語 + would (should, could , might) + 動詞原形 + …… 1.If I were you, I would go with him. (從句 If I were you, 主句 I would go with him.) 2.If I were you, I should buy it. (從句用過去式動詞were,,主句用動詞原形 buy) 3.If I had time, I would study French. (如果有時間,我會學習法文,。) ?。◤木溆眠^去式動詞had,主句用動詞原形 study) 4. If she knew English, she would not ask me for help. (如果她懂英文,,她就不必要我?guī)土恕? (從句用過去式動詞knew, 主句用動詞原形ask) 注意:如果動作在進行中,,主句要用:"主語 + would be + 進行式動詞 + ……" 5. If they were here, he would be speaking to them now. (從句用過去式動詞were, 主句用 would be speaking) 8.2 與過去事實相反的假設(假設從句的事實為過去的事): 從句:If + 主語 + had +過去完成式動詞 + …… 主句:主語 + would (should, could, might) + have +過去完成式動詞 +…… 1. If you had studied harder last term, you could have passed exam. (從句動詞用had studied, 主句動詞用have passed) 如果你在上個學期用功一些,你就會在考試中過關了,。 2. If you had taken my advice, you wouldn't have failed in the exam. (從句動詞用had taken, 主句動詞用have failed) 如果你當時聽從我的勸告的話,,你就不會在考試中失敗了。 3. If you had got up earlier, you could have caught the train. (從句動詞用had got up, 主句動詞用 have caught) 如果你起身得早一點,,你就會趕得上火車了,。 4. If it had snowed, I would have skied in the park. (從句動詞用had snowed, 主句動詞用 have skied) 如果下雪的話,我就可在公園里滑雪了,。 注意:如果動作在進行中,,主句要用:"I主語 + would + have + 完成進行式動詞+…… 5.If they had been here, he would have been speaking to them. (從句動詞用had been, 主句動詞用 have been speaking) 8.3 與將來的事實可能相反(對將來的事實實現(xiàn)的可能性不大): 從句:If + 主語 + should (或were) + 動詞原形 +…… 主句:主語 + would (could, should, might) + 動詞原形 +…… 1. If it should rain, the crops would be saved. (從句動詞用should rain,主句動詞用 be) 如果天下雨,,莊稼可能就收獲了,。 2. If he were to go fomorrow, he might tell you. (從句動詞用were to, 主句動詞用 tell) 如果明天他走的話,他可能會告訴你,。 3.If he were here, I would give him the books. (從句動詞用 were, 主句動詞用 give) 如果他在這兒,,我可能會把書給他。 注意:如果動作在進行中,,從句(不是主句喔)要用:"If + 主語 + 過去進行式動詞+……" 4.If she were staying here now, I would let her ride my horse. (從句動詞用 were staying, 主句動詞用 let) 如果她現(xiàn)在留在這兒,,我可能會讓她騎我的馬。 8.4 從句的 If 有時可省略,,那么從句中的動詞(were, had, should)就得移到主語前面: 1.原句:If she were younger, she would do it. 去If:Were she younger, she would do it. (把動詞were移到主語she的前面) 2.原句:If he had tried it, he could have done it. 去If:Had he tried it, he could have done it.(把had移到主語he的前面) 8.5 有時虛擬條件句的從句或主句都可以省略其中一個: 1. I could help you.(只有主句) 2. If I had time. (只有從句) 3. She should have come to the meeting. (只有主句) 4. If he had much more money. (只有從句) 8.6 有時虛擬條件句的從句和主句地動詞動作時態(tài)會不一致: 8.6.1 從句表示過去,,主句表示將來: If they had started the early morning yesterday, they would be here now. 8.6.2 從句表示將來,主句表示過去: If I were not to make a preparation for my experiment this afternoon, I would have gone to see the film with you last night. 8.6.3 從句表示過去,,主句表示將來: If we hadn't made adequate preparations, we shouldn't dare to do the experiment next week. 8.6.4 從句表示將來,,主句表示現(xiàn)在: If we shouldn't have an exam this afternoon, I would go shopping now. 談談虛擬語氣(Subjunctive Mood)(八) 九、其他虛擬語氣在句子中的應用: 9.1 用as if (或 as though 好象) 的狀語從句,,表示與事實相反: 1. He pretends as if he didn't know the thing at all, but in fact he knows it very well. ?。ㄓ眠^去式表示與現(xiàn)在事實相反的假設) 他假裝好象完全不懂那事,其實他對那事非常了解,。 2. The old man looked at the picture, he felt as though he had gone back to time 20 years ago. (用過去完成式表示與過去相反的事實) 那老人看著照片,,他覺得仿佛回到20年前的時光。 3. They talked and talked as if they would never meet again. (would + 原形動詞meet,,表示與將來事實相反) 他們談了又談,,仿佛他們不會再相見的樣子,。 9.2 用 had hoped 表示原來希望做到而實際上未能實現(xiàn)的事情。其賓語從句的謂語要用"would + 動詞原形": 1. I had hoped that she would go to the U.S. and study there, but she said she liked to stay in China.我原本希望她到美國去念書,,但她說她喜歡留在中國,。 9.3 用 without / but for / in the absence of 表示"要不是"、"如果沒有",,表示條件虛擬句: 1.Without air, nothing could live. 要是沒有空氣,,什么也不能生存。 2.But for your assistance, we could not accomplish it. 要不是你的幫忙,,我們是難有成就的,。 3.In the absence of water and air, nothing could live. 如果沒有水和空氣,什么也不能生存,。 |
|